Achenbach Child Behavior Checklist

The Achenbach Child Behavior Checklist is a questionnaire that assesses the behavior and development of children. It can be used by teachers and parents and covers many categories of emotional and behavior development.

The CBCL comprises more than 100 items, rated on the basis of a three-point scale. Its use has been controversial in the past. However it's true that the CBCL has a long-standing history of research and clinical applications.

Of all the scales that can be used for assessing the development and behavior problems of children among them, the CBCL is the most well-known. It has an Youth Self Report Form and a Teacher Report form. These forms are particularly useful in assessing classroom behavior.

The CBCL is not only standardized but also includes adaptive measures. For instance the CBCL now includes several narrow-band syndrome scales. It also includes self-report measurements and a developmental history form.

One of the most important advantages of a checklist with a standard is to highlight aspects that might be missed by the teacher or parent interviewer. This can help to evaluate the effectiveness of an intervention. A standardized checklist can also be beneficial in that it takes less time to score and analyze data.

Historically, behavior-rating scales have been a crucial tool for the evaluation of emotional and behavioral issues of children and adolescents. The CBCL is an example of a new kind of checklist that incorporates the best aspects of traditional scales and modern technology.

Although the CBCL has been in existence for decades It has seen a number of advancements in its current version. It has, for instance it has added DSM-oriented scales to the response format , and also introduced the Youth Self-Report Form.

Test of Variables of Attention

Test of Variables of Attention (TOVA) is a continuous performance test that measures attention and impulsivity. It is composed of two stimuli and takes about 21 minutes to administer.

TOVA is used for early detection of attention disorders. It can be used to detect and identify attention deficits. TOVA is an objective indicator, in contrast to self-report scales. It utilizes standardized multimedia instructions in eight languages to give easy-to-read, understandable results.

Test of Variables of Attention is a type of computer-administered, continuous performance test that assesses attention and impulsivity. It has been shown to be a reliable and effective method for detecting ADHD. One study used the TOVA to identify adhd assessment cost in children.

The TOVA is a 21-minute, computer-administered, continuous attention performance test. The duration of the test is affected by a variety of factors. For instance, gender, education level and sex can affect the length of the test. The average TOVA period was 21.6 minutes, but this may differ from one to one.

TOVA is used to assess the different types of attention that are available such as sustained and immediate attention in the areas of vigilance, omission and impulse control. The test is administered with an electronic software program. Participants need to press a microswitch to finish the test. During the test, errors of omission occur when the test subject fails to press the microswitch after the target is displayed. These errors are an indication of inattention.

The TOVA has been shown to be effective in assessing attentional processes in adults. However, it is not clear whether the test could be used for children who are just starting out. An age-normalized version is now available. Participants must press a button to react to monochromatic targets.

Conners 3

A Conners 3 assessment is helpful for children who have been diagnosed with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(book adhd assessment uk), or any other condition that is comorbid. It can provide a detailed and accurate description of the child's issues and aid in the development of the best strategies for intervention. In addition to diagnosing ADHD, it can also identify conduct disorder, oppositional defiance disorder and other related problems.

The Conners Rating Scales are among of the most popular parent-rated scales to assess behavioral issues. It has been tested and proven to be reliable in the U.S. version. Now it has been updated to strengthen the connections to the DSM-IVTR.

It can be administered online or with a pen. It is recommended to consult a physician before using the Conners rating system. Based on the kind of Conners rating scale employed, some forms contain versions for parents and teachers.

The Conners 3(r) forms are used to measure the range of behavior of children between the ages of six and eighteen years. These forms are frequently used to determine a diagnosis and to monitor the effectiveness of treatment. These forms are helpful for parents, teachers professionals, professionals, and many others.

This assessment adhd is based on a series of questions that are in a Likert-scale format. Answer the questions honestly. Certain questions can be answered that are either very true/frequently or not at all, or a combination of both.

The assessors will take into consideration the past, personality, and behavioral observations when conducting an Conners 3 assessment. They will also conduct cognitive or behavioral assessment tests. The evaluator will contact clients to explain the results of the assessment.

Conners3 differs from other assessments because it makes use of a variety of sources of data to collect information. In addition to a self-report survey, it includes a teacher-rating scale, a scale for parents and a rating scale for each client.

Vanderbilt Assessment Scales For ADHD

The Vanderbilt Assessment Scales is a quick scale that can be used by parents to determine ADHD symptoms in children. They are part of a larger project known as the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der Learning Collaborative.

They are a fantastic tool for screening. They are able to detect common comorbid conditions. They do not intend to replace a clinical interview.

These scales are used to detect ADHD and other disorders. They are based upon the Fourth Edition of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ders. In addition, they possess solid internal consistency and an excellent factor structure.

These tests are designed to test for behavior problems that have occurred in the past six months. They look for signs of depression and conduct disorders. They are employed by speech pathologists and pediatricians. Certain tests offer a shorter checklist of symptoms for depression.

Symptoms of ADHD can include hyperactivity as well as the tendency to be impulsive. Teachers, parents and medical professionals may complete rating scales to determine if your child has adhd assessment scotland.

A score of 2.56 or higher indicates that a child is suffering from ADHD. Children may also be screened for the presence of oppositional defiant disorder (ODD). This is a condition that causes oppositional, chronic stubbornness, inability, and refusal to follow the rules. It is found in around 25% of children who have ADHD. It is a type of ADHD.

Other tests employ questionnaires that ask about the child's medical history. They can aid clinicians in their focus on other aspects of the child's health.

There are many ADHD assessment scales available however, the NICHQ Vanderbilt Assessment Scans are geared towards children ages 6-12. These tests were created by the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der Learning Collaborative.

Each test uses a different method of scoring that determines if the person is suffering from ADHD. All of these tests are useful, but they don't provide a definitive diagnosis. Only an experienced doctor can accurately diagnose.
